Hey guys! I just picked up an MPC 2500. I already owned a 5000, and was wondering how I could take .50s programs from my 5000 and put them on my 2500. I already saved my .50s's as PGM files and picked 'save as MPC1000' in the window, but my programs transfer horribly. My pitch changing doesn't save, my volume levels don't save, my panning doesn't save, among other weird little things. Any advice would be amazing! Thanks.

The PGM conversion in the 5000 is basic, so if it's not working for you that's as much as you can expect I'm afraid. The MPC Software can load your 50s files and then convert to 1000/2500 format, but you're then dealing with two conversion processes (50s to XPM, then XPM to PGM) - suffice to say the MPC Software export/import is just as bad as the 5000.

Welcome to the 'iconic legacy' part of the MPC line, where newer MPCs don't always play 'nice' with the previous MPC in the range. They usually get basic pad assignments okay, but after that it's fingers crossed and hope for the best.

Be thankful that you don't have a pre-Numark MPC, because Akai have never supported export to those MPCs whatsoever (import yes, export no - absolute pain when trying to make samplepacks multi-MPC compatible)
